R.C. Chandna's Geography of Population (often published by Kalyani Publishers) is a foundational text for students and researchers in human geography. It provides a comprehensive analysis of population dynamics, particularly through a spatial lens, with significant emphasis on Indian population patterns. Key Features of the Text

- Distribution and Density: This is often the most asked-about topic in exams. Chandna explains why people live where they live, analyzing the physical, socio-economic, and historical factors behind the Ganges plains being densely populated versus the sparse populations of the Thar Desert.
- Composition of Population: Understanding the demographic dividend? You need to understand age-sex pyramids. This section breaks down the structural composition of the Indian population, including literacy rates and occupational structures.
- Migration Trends: Moving beyond simple rural-to-urban migration, the text explores the complex patterns of internal migration in India, offering insights that are still relevant to modern urban planning discussions.
